What Are Windows Updates?
Windows updates are patches released by Microsoft to fix bugs, improve security, and add new features. They are vital in keeping your operating system running smoothly.
The Importance of Regular Updates
Regularly updating your system protects against vulnerabilities, enhances performance, and ensures compatibility with new applications.
Security Benefits
Windows updates often contain critical security patches that protect your system from threats and attacks. Without these updates, your computer is more vulnerable to malware.
Performance Improvements
Updates can include performance enhancements that help your system run faster and more efficiently. These improvements can make a noticeable difference in your daily computing tasks.
How to Check for Updates
To check for updates, navigate to Settings > Update & Security > Windows Update. Click 'Check for updates' to see if any updates are available.
Managing Windows Updates
You can choose to have updates installed automatically or manually. Automatic updates are recommended to ensure your system remains protected.
